NATHALIE OUDIN Chablis 1er Cru Vaugiraut 2018 75cl White
Grape Variety: Chardonnay
Terroir: The vines are located around the village of Chichée, south of Chablis, on the banks of the river "Le Serein". The vines are on hillsides or on the tops of hills around the village, at an altitude of approximately 150m. Most of them face South or Southwest.
Vinification/Aging: It is as non-interventionist as possible. They favor textured, rich, and full-bodied musts. Natural fermentations thanks to the yeasts and lactic bacteria naturally present on our grapes. Aging in stainless steel tanks on lees for as long as possible until bottling before the next harvest. The Chablis "les serres" cuvée remains in tank for 24 months. 35 mg/L of free sulfur at bottling.
Tasting Notes: Aromas of flowers such as linden but also offers more empyreumatic aromas such as licorice. With a beautiful balance and powerful minerality from the marl in which it is rooted, it is a very good wine for cellaring.
The estate was created in 1985 by Nathalie and Isabelle's parents. Since 2007, Nathalie has been managing the estate after studying oenology and gaining professional experience in France and elsewhere. In 2012, Isabelle joined her.
Today, they cultivate 10 hectares of Chardonnay, all with a qualitative and environmentally respectful viticulture.
